During the swiftly evolving landscape on the digital globe, the part of a web engineer has reworked from very simple site constructing to sophisticated software package engineering, producing Frontend Improvement a crucial willpower for business achievement. As we transfer via 2026, the demand from customers for remarkably interactive, lightning-rapidly, and obtainable person interfaces is at an all-time significant. It is actually no longer sufficient to simply make a website look good; the underlying code must be strong, scalable, and economical. Mastering Frontend Improvement will involve a constant dedication to Understanding new frameworks, knowing browser rendering engines, and adhering to rigorous coding criteria. By prioritizing clean up architecture and maintainability, teams can lower technical personal debt and ensure that their digital products can adapt to upcoming adjustments in technological know-how with no demanding a complete overhaul.
The philosophy at the rear of present day Frontend Advancement is rooted in the notion of user-centric engineering. Just about every line of code written includes a immediate effect on the tip-person's experience, regardless of whether as a result of load occasions, interactive feedback, or visual stability. As a result, a arduous method of Frontend Progress is important for meeting Main Website Vitals and making sure high search engine rankings. This tutorial will take a look at the foundational ideas and advanced methods that determine major-tier engineering nowadays. From Arranging ingredient libraries to optimizing vital rendering paths, We are going to protect the important ways necessary to elevate your workflow and make Expert-quality computer software.
Furthermore, the collaboration concerning designers and developers is tighter than in the past. Frontend Development functions as being the bridge between Innovative eyesight and technical fact. Productive implementation demands not simply coding abilities, but additionally a deep comprehension of layout programs and person empathy. As we delve into your particulars of HTML, CSS, and JavaScript optimization, do not forget that the ultimate target of Frontend Enhancement is to solve problems for consumers in by far the most successful way possible. Enable’s study the ideal methods that independent amateur coding from business-amount engineering.
Frontend Growth Approaches for Organizing Venture Architecture
The longevity of any Website application is determined just before only one line of enterprise logic is published; it begins Together with the file structure. Powerful Frontend Development requires a modular approach to architecture. Prior to now, developers may have thrown all their documents right into a couple generic folders, but fashionable apps demand a component-based framework. What this means is grouping data files by feature or area in lieu of file kind. As an example, retaining the CSS, screening files, and JavaScript logic for any "Button" element in a similar Listing permits less complicated upkeep. This modularity is a trademark of Skilled Frontend Improvement, permitting teams to scale without stepping on each other's toes.
Point out administration is yet another architectural pillar. No matter whether making use of Redux, Context API, or newer alerts-based mostly strategies, handling how facts flows via an application is crucial. Weak point out management results in "prop drilling" and unpredictable bugs. Superior-quality Frontend Progress will involve organizing the condition hierarchy to make sure that details is obtainable wherever necessary but protected from unneeded re-renders. By creating very clear principles for information circulation, Frontend Growth groups can Make elaborate, interactive dashboards that keep on being performant and predictable whilst the appliance grows in dimension and complexity.
Frontend Growth Standards for Producing Semantic HTML
Although frameworks like Respond and Vue frequently abstract the DOM, crafting semantic HTML stays the bedrock of the world wide web. Frontend Enhancement need to prioritize semantics to make sure accessibility and Search engine marketing success. Employing generic `div` tags for everything is a bad observe that confuses monitor readers and search bots. In its place, utilizing things like `header`, `nav`, `primary`, and `post` gives which means and context to the content material. This exercise makes sure that your Frontend Enhancement endeavours bring about a web page that is definitely navigable by Everybody, no matter their Actual physical qualities or the devices they use.
Accessibility (a11y) just isn't an afterthought; This is a core necessity. Present day Frontend Advancement contains the implementation of ARIA (Accessible Prosperous Online Apps) labels only when important, relying primarily on indigenous HTML aspects that have developed-in accessibility features. As an illustration, employing a `button` tag for actions and an `anchor` tag for navigation seems easy, nevertheless it is commonly ignored. Adhering to those expectations is a specialist accountability. By baking accessibility into your Frontend Enhancement course of action from day a person, you stay away from high priced remediation retrofits afterwards and broaden your prospective viewers access.
Frontend Development Strategies for Economical CSS Architecture
Styling modern-day web applications can speedily become a tangled mess of more info conflicting guidelines Otherwise managed correctly. Frontend Improvement ideal procedures advocate for methodologies that encapsulate types, including BEM (Block Ingredient Modifier) or CSS Modules. These strategies protect against type leakage, making certain that a change to a class within the footer does not unintentionally crack the format in the header. The goal of Frontend Enhancement in this space is to produce a predictable styling process where by Visible regressions are minimized.
The rise of utility-first CSS frameworks like Tailwind has also shifted the paradigm. As opposed to crafting custom CSS For each and every part, developers use pre-defined utility lessons to construct interfaces directly from the markup. This approach accelerates Frontend Advancement drastically by cutting down the need to swap context in between HTML and CSS information. Additionally, it brings about more compact bundle dimensions since utility courses are extremely reusable. Whatever the unique methodology picked, regularity is key. A unified approach to styling is what distinguishes a sophisticated products from a chaotic prototype in the world of Frontend Improvement.
Frontend Progress Finest Tactics Pertaining to JavaScript Functionality
JavaScript will be the motor of the modern World wide web, but it is also the costliest useful resource concerning processing electric power. Frontend Advancement ought to emphasis aggressively on reducing the amount of JavaScript despatched to your client. Strategies like "tree shaking" clear away unused code throughout the Establish system, whilst "code splitting" breaks the applying into lesser chunks which can be loaded on demand from customers. By ensuring that the browser only downloads the code essential for The existing check out, Frontend Advancement gurus can drastically increase The perfect time to Interactive (TTI) scores.
Another important element is handling the key thread. If extensive-jogging responsibilities block the key thread, the consumer interface freezes, leading to disappointment. Sophisticated Frontend Growth requires employing Web Staff to dump significant computations or breaking apart extended tasks into scaled-down asynchronous operations. This retains the UI buttery sleek. Also, avoiding memory leaks by effectively cleansing up party listeners and intervals is a sign of mature Frontend Advancement. These overall performance optimizations are important for retaining consumers on cellular products with limited processing power and battery existence.
Frontend Progress Deal with Website Accessibility Rules
In 2026, inclusivity is non-negotiable. Frontend Development plays a pivotal function in making certain compliance with WCAG (Online page Accessibility Rules). This goes over and above screen website audience; it involves keyboard navigation, colour contrast ratios, and minimized movement Choices. A website that cannot be navigated by means of the `Tab` vital is basically broken. Therefore, screening for keyboard traps and emphasis management is really a routine A part of the Frontend Growth workflow. Implementing concentrate indicators—the outline that seems close to picked elements—can help users know where These are within the webpage.
Shade distinction is another major spot. Designers may well love delicate greys, but In case the contrast ratio is just too small, the textual content gets to be unreadable for countless buyers with Visible impairments. Frontend Growth involves auditing these possibilities making use of automatic tools and guide checks. In addition, supporting "Darkish Mode" and "High Contrast Manner" by way of CSS media queries respects consumer Tastes. By prioritizing these functions, Frontend Improvement makes sure that the electronic merchandise is moral, lawful, and usable through the widest feasible demographic.
Frontend Development Applications to Automate Workflow and Screening
To take care of higher specifications without having slowing down generation, automation is essential. Frontend Development relies on a collection of applications to enforce consistency. Linters like ESLint assess code for opportunity glitches and stylistic deviations, though formatters like Prettier be certain that all code follows a Frontend Development uniform design guideline. Integrating these resources in the CI/CD (Continuous Integration/Steady Deployment) pipeline helps prevent lousy code from becoming merged. This automation makes it possible for Frontend Growth teams to focus on logic instead of arguing about semicolon placement.
Tests is check here the protection Internet of software engineering. Frontend Improvement contains composing unit tests for specific features, integration assessments for ingredient interactions, and finish-to-conclusion (E2E) checks for important person flows. Applications like Jest, Vitest, and Cypress make this process manageable. A strong take a look at suite permits builders to refactor legacy code with confidence, figuring out that any regressions are going to be caught quickly. Investing time in crafting exams is an indicator of higher-excellent Frontend Progress that pays dividends in lengthy-phrase steadiness.
Frontend Development Tendencies Involving Frameworks and Libraries
The ecosystem is large, with Respond, Vue, Svelte, and Hyperbaric Chamber Near by Me Angular vying for dominance. However, the most effective Frontend Advancement apply is not really about picking out the "best" framework, but the correct just one for that occupation. React remains a powerhouse on account of its huge ecosystem, but more recent frameworks like SolidJS offer general performance benefits by compiling away the virtual DOM. Knowledge the trade-offs concerning these resources is a critical ability in Frontend Development. It necessitates wanting beyond the hoopla to evaluate community assistance, extended-term viability, and effectiveness traits.
Server-Side Rendering (SSR) and Static Website Generation (SSG) have also grow to be regular. Frameworks like Following.js and Nuxt have blurred the road in between frontend and backend. Frontend Development now normally involves crafting code that operates on the server to pre-render internet pages for speed and Web optimization. This "hybrid" technique provides the very best of both worlds: the interactivity of one-site software Using the discoverability of a static web site. Remaining up to date on these architectural shifts is essential for anybody serious about Frontend Development.
Frontend Growth Upcoming and Continual Learning
The only regular in this industry is transform. Frontend Progress is often a job of lifelong Understanding. New browser APIs, CSS characteristics, and JavaScript benchmarks are released regularly. What was very best apply two a long time ago may be thought of an anti-pattern right now. Participating Using the Neighborhood as a result of open up-resource contributions, studying documentation, and building aspect jobs retains capabilities sharp. The way forward for Frontend Advancement will possible include far more AI-assisted coding and even increased emphasis on overall performance, even so the core concepts of cleanliness, composition, and consumer empathy will continue to be eternal.
In summary, constructing for the world wide web is actually a craft that demands precision and foresight. Frontend Development is definitely the artwork of balancing aesthetics, performance, and functionality. By adhering to the very best methods of modular architecture, semantic HTML, effective CSS, and strong screening, you produce electronic experiences that stand the examination of your time. Regardless if you are engaged on a large organization System or a private portfolio, treating Frontend Progress With all the rigor of engineering makes sure good results from the electronic age.